About Gullesfjord Camping
Gullesfjord Camping is located in breathtaking natural surroundings deep inside a fjord inlet – on the threshold between the coastal shoreline and alpine mountains. At the same time, Route E10 is at our doorstep; we lie mid-way between Kiruna and Lofoten. We are near larger municipal centres: 23 km to Lødingen and 33 km to Sortland. Our facilities include 15 cabins as well as 55 caravan sites with electrical hook-ups. Our service centre has sanitary facilities including toilets, showers, a sauna, washing machine and tumble dryer. We also feature a large kitchen for food preparation and doing the dishes. We have a chemical toilet emptying point.

History
Gullesfjord camping began cautiously in 1959 – with a café and two small, woodstove-heated cabins. At the time, access to and transport in the fjord was by boat only.
When the main road was completed in 1964, the facilities were gradually expanded with several cabins and a sanitary building. Overnight accommodation was also added to the building housing the café.
In 1994, the main building was destroyed by fire. Following a lengthy rebuilding effort, the café and the new sanitary building were completed in 2003.
